Web27 Feb 2024 · 安 or ān is the Chinese character for peace. In this symbol, you will find that there is a roof (宀) along with the character of a woman (女 or nǚ) underneath it. Chinese Peace Symbol. This symbol associates peace with femininity and might represent the thought that an ideal home is being managed by an assiduous woman. Thai Chinese (also known as Chinese Thais, Sino-Thais), Thais of Chinese origin (Thai: ชาวไทยเชื้อสายจีน; exonym and also domestically) are Chinese descendants in Thailand. Thai Chinese are the largest minority group in the country and the largest overseas Chinese community in the world with a population of approximately 7-10 million people, accounting for 11–14% of th…
